Transaction e83ad59ffcde2833dda95f2ae2fd85372ad1782ddce74d118ea64530d0d220e7
1 Input
1 Output
-
e83ad59ffcde2833dda95f2ae2fd85372ad1782ddce74d118ea64530d0d220e7:0
- value
- 1815771
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23870c32ce38b8b204d7291a14159013fc1eeea2 OP_EQUAL
- address
- 34vsMXsTN1hiKJvSGSU1dFSjWj59f6ChYs